Role Mission The Network Engineer is responsible for the daily performance and availability of the organization’s Local and Wide Area Networks (LAN & WAN). Analyze the network and support all users, including team members and clients, and fix any issues related to TCP OSI layers 1 to 4. Other Job responsibilities: Maintain network installation, circuit integration, network equipment maintenance, and operations. Configure, monitor, and troubleshoot L2 and L3 network issues. Prepare monthly network availability report. Maintaining the network infrastructure by troubleshooting problems with Firewall, routers, switches, wireless controllers, wireless access points, etc. Create BOM for new, faulty and EOL network devices. Implement software upgrades or patches on network-related devices. Maintaining records of network activity such as logs of user activity or system performance metrics Facilitate Change Management requests and execution according to SOP or MOP Ensure network documentations are up to date Requirements Bachelor's degree (B.Sc.) or Higher National Diploma (HND) in computer science, information technology, computer engineering, or a related field. Minimum 2 – 4 years of working experience in the same or related position. Cisco and Networking certifications; CCNP, Fortinet NSE4 & Palo-Alto PCNSE Experience working with networking protocols, including TCP/IP, IPsec, DMVPN, GRE, VxLAN, VRRP, OSPF, and EIGRP. Proficient in Unified Threat Management (UTM) Solutions. Excellent communication skills. Benefits
